Understanding How Laser Hair Removal Actually Works
Laser hair removal has changed how we deal with unwanted hair. It uses light to target and stop hair follicles without harming the skin. At Capri Med Spa, the Soprano Titanium system gives precise, painless results.
The Science Behind Targeting Hair Follicles
Laser treatment works through selective photothermolysis. This is when light turns to heat in a specific target. The laser sends light that melanin in the hair absorbs.
This process creates heat that damages the follicle. It stops the hair from growing without harming the skin.
How Laser Energy Disrupts Hair Growth Cycles
Your hair goes through four growth cycles. This is why one treatment can’t remove all unwanted hair:
- Anagen (active growth phase) – when hair is most responsive to laser treatment
- Catagen (transitional phase) – follicle shrinks and detaches
- Telogen (resting phase) – old hair rests while new hair forms
- Exogen (shedding phase) – old hair falls out
The laser works best during the anagen phase. But only 20-30% of hair is in this phase at any time. So, multiple treatments are needed for full results.
Why Multiple Sessions Are Necessary
For the best results, schedule sessions 4-6 weeks apart. This catches different hair follicles as they grow. Most people need 6-8 treatments for a big reduction.
Some may need annual maintenance sessions. The Soprano Titanium’s cooling tech makes these sessions comfortable. This allows for better results without pain.
Targeting follicles across multiple sessions leads to lasting results. This is why laser hair removal is better than waxing or shaving.

Factors That Influence Hair Regrowth Post-Treatment
Laser hair removal works differently for everyone. Knowing what affects your results can help you understand what to expect.
Hormonal Changes and Their Impact
Hormonal changes are a big factor in hormonal hair regrowth after laser treatments. Women often see hair return on the chin, neck, and upper lip during big life changes. This includes pregnancy, menopause, and conditions like PCOS, which change hormone levels and wake up dormant hair follicles.
Up to 90% of follicles respond well to laser treatment. But, hormone-sensitive areas often need more sessions to keep the results.
The Role of Genetics in Hair Growth Patterns
Your genes greatly influence your hair growth and how you react to laser treatments. If your family has thick or excessive hair, you might need more sessions. Research shows some people might need up to eight sessions for the best results.
How Your Hair and Skin Type Affects Results
It’s important to consider your skin type when thinking about laser treatment success. Laser technology targets the melanin in hair follicles. This is why:
- Dark hair on light skin usually works best
- Blonde, red, gray, or white hair doesn’t respond well
- Darker skin tones need special laser settings to avoid pigmentation changes

The Truth About “Permanent” Hair Reduction vs. Complete Removal
Knowing what laser hair treatments can do is key. The FDA calls it “permanent hair reduction,” not “complete removal.” This is because laser treatments like Soprano Titanium mostly stop hair growth, but not always completely.
Most people see a 70-90% reduction in hair after treatment. Any new hair is finer, lighter, and less noticeable. This makes it easy to keep your skin smooth with little upkeep.
The lasting effects of laser treatments vary by area:
- Underarms and bikini areas see the most lasting results
- Facial areas might need occasional touch-ups because of hormones
- Body hair that grows back is usually finer and lighter

Post-Treatment Care for Optimal Results
Good post-treatment hair care is key for the best results. Right after, the treated area might feel a bit warm, like a mild sunburn. In 3-5 days, you’ll start to see the hairs fall out, and this can last up to two weeks.
To get the best results, stay out of the sun and avoid tanning beds for 48 hours. Don’t wax, tweeze, or pluck between sessions. This way, the laser can target the right hair follicles. Finishing your full treatment series will give you the best results.
